Title: Subject: Billboard Relocation Agreement From: Community and Economic Development Agency Recommendation: Adopt a Resolution authorizing the City Manater to enter into a Billboard Relocation Agreement on behalf of the City with Clear Channel Outdoor Advertising Signs to waive their rights to compensation, including all real property and personal property interests for six Billboards located at 1998 and 1972 San Pablo Avenue, 605 Thomas Berkley Way (20th Street) and 1975 Telegraph Avenue in the Central District Urban Renewal Area and two double faced billboard structures containing four outdoor advertising signs located at 1414 73rd Avenue, in exchange for the relocation and reconstruction of a prior Billboard along Hegenburger Road in the Coliseum Redevelopment Area
